Butch Baldassari benefit show 10/22

Butch BaldassariMandolin Cafe has posted details for a special all-star show in Nashville on October 22, all for the benefit of Butch Baldassari. The show will be held on the Vanderbilt University campus at 7:00 p.m.

Butch has been battling a brain tumor with intense and aggressive treatments, and the proceeds from this concert will go help defray his many medical expenses - and other financial obligations he faces.

Performers who are slated to appear include Butch’s Nashville Mandolin Ensemble, The Nashville Bluegrass Band, Bela Fleck, Dierks Bentley, 3 Ring Circle, John Cowan and several others.

Most of our readers know that Butch is a veteran bluegrass and mandolin music artist, writer and arranger who also founded and manages his own label, Sound Art Recordings. He is a long time friend to our music, and one who has contributed greatly to its excellence and continued expansion.

For those unable to attend the 10/22 show, donations to his medical fund can be made through Mandolin Cafe, where they have set up a support fund for Butch.
